Those three words you say

Perfectionism

You colour me with your inner eyes. "Stop being a perfectionist," you say. No, I'm just trying to do my very best before coming to you so I don't waste your precious time. Afterall I would never want you to waste mine.

Defensive

You accuse me of being defensive. "There is no need to be so defensive about the decisions you have made." No, I'm just trying to explain so we don't walk away with misunderstandings. How else will I ever know whether you have truly grasped the concept I conveyed?

Secretive

You paint me as someone with a bag full of secrets held closely to my chest, a walking Fort Knox.

"You are very secretive," you say. No, I am merely reserved, preferring to observe and contemplate beforehand inviting you in. Those three words you say and I know you don't understand me.
